Rambler's Top100
Форум: MS ACCESSVBVBA MS OfficeMS SQL server
Новые сообщения: 0000

Форум: MS ACCESS

Вопросы связанные с MS ACCESS

Обновить визитку
Участники «Online»
Все участники

 
 

Доброго времени суток, Посетитель!

вид форума:
Линейный форум Структурный форум

тема: Подобие условного форматирования в MSA2000
 
 автор: Dutch Shultz   (02.10.2008 в 16:15)   личное сообщение
 
 

Подскажите,пож-ста,как лучше всего реализовать,чтобы при открытии формы все даты столбца А,которые меньше дат столбца Б автоматически заливались каким-то цветом и при вводе даты в столбец А, которая меньше даты столбца Б в соответсвующей записи,тоже автоматически заливалась определенным цветом.Заранее спасибо!

  Ответить  
 
 автор: FORMAT   (02.10.2008 в 17:31)   личное сообщение
 
 

Пробегаемся рекордсетом по табличке, сравниваем даты. если датаА<датыБ, меняем фореколор на нужный цвет.

Аналогично, при вводе сравниваются даты и меняется фореколор.

  Ответить  
 
 автор: Lukas   (02.10.2008 в 17:42)   личное сообщение
 
 

На ленточной форме этот фокус не пройдет.

  Ответить  
 
 автор: Dutch Shultz   (02.10.2008 в 17:53)   личное сообщение
 
 

Вот и у меня что-то не получилось...Есть ли выход какой?Как можно обратиться в ленточной форме к конкретной ячейке ,чтобы построчно сравнивать значения в ячейках,и где надо закрашивать,а где не надо оставлять-а то закрашивается целый столбик

  Ответить  
 
 автор: Lukas   (02.10.2008 в 18:29)   личное сообщение
25 Кб.
 
 

Обратите внимание на запрос - источник данных формы.

  Ответить  
 
 автор: Dutch Shultz   (02.10.2008 в 18:49)   личное сообщение
 
 

Будьте добры - поподробнее.

  Ответить  
 
 автор: Lukas   (02.10.2008 в 18:55)   личное сообщение
 
 

Извините не понял о чем подробнее, о запросе?

  Ответить  
 
 автор: Dutch Shultz   (02.10.2008 в 19:25)   личное сообщение
 
 

Да,извините,я просто не понял,что Вы имеете в виду.

  Ответить  
 
 автор: Анатолий (Киев)   (02.10.2008 в 18:59)   личное сообщение
 
 

А почему "Подобие условного форматирования в MSA2000"? Здесь оно и просится.
Или у вас А97?

  Ответить  
 
 автор: Dutch Shultz   (02.10.2008 в 19:15)   личное сообщение
 
 

Нет,у меня А2000.Только в условном форматировании он просит ввести значение,а как можно сослаться на значение ячейки из этой же записи.Т.е.предлагает сравнить значение ячейки в этом столбце с каким-то значением,а мне нужно по каждой записи сравнить 2 столбца и если 1 больше другого,то закрасить его в цвет.

  Ответить  
 
 автор: Lukas   (02.10.2008 в 19:53)   личное сообщение
25 Кб.
 
 

Вариант с условным форматированием в форме "frmItem"

  Ответить  
HiProg.com - Технологии программирования
Rambler's Top100 TopList